- Last year, meat production amounted to approximately 400 million kilograms, almost two per cent more than in 2018
- Beef production increased by one per cent to just under 88 million kilograms.
- Pork production amounted to just over 171 million kilograms, one per cent more than in 2018.
- The production of poultry meat continued to increase last year, and was a little over 139 million kilograms. Both the production of broiler meat and turkey meat increased by three per cent from the previous year.
- The production of mutton took a slight downward turn last year. Approximately 1.5 million kilograms of mutton was produced, which was just over two per cent less than in 2018.
- Organic meat production amounted to 3.8 million kilograms, two per cent more than in 2018.
